Understanding Aryaka MPLS Limitations: A Critical Assessment

While Aryaka’s MPLS offering presents a attractive solution for several businesses, it vital to recognize its inherent limitations. Unlike traditional MPLS, Aryaka's methodology leverages a unique SD-WAN architecture, which, although usually enhances performance, can face specific difficulties in particular scenarios. Consider latency-sensitive programs requiring precise determinism might never function ideally due to the underlying characteristics of SD-WAN, even with Aryaka's enhancement techniques. Furthermore, geographic-based limitations may affect network reach in less-developed areas, arguably limiting the extent of Aryaka’s offering.

  • Assess coverage in remote areas.
  • Examine latency behavior for essential services.
  • Factor in possible dependencies on external platforms.
Ultimately, a detailed assessment of Aryaka’s MPLS functionality requires a practical evaluation against individual business demands.

Aryaka WAN Optimization vs. MPLS: Choosing the Right Solution

Selecting the appropriate network for your business can be difficult . Many businesses are confronted by the decision of adopting either Aryaka's WAN optimization service or traditional Multiprotocol Label Switching . Aryaka provides a cloud-based approach that can significantly boost application delivery, particularly for remote teams; however, MPLS remains a reliable option for particular use cases. Consider elements like budget, delay , and security to identify which strategy is the superior option for your unique demands.
